How We Integrate Link-First

AssetsCompliance uses a link-first integration approach. It is designed to connect to existing systems as control infrastructure for regulated organisations without replacing systems of record.

Review-stage boundary: No live client data is required for practitioner review, and production connector claims are not part of the current public website.

Future direction: Read-only and governed sync patterns can be validated later where they support control visibility and a defensible basis for reliance.
